In Reading, we’ll read Mayday, Mayday!: A Coast Guard Rescue! In this book the United States Coast Guard leaps into action when they hear a call for help. A team of four highly trained rescue specialists head out in an H-60 Jayhawk helicopter. Battling fierce conditions, the Coast Guard team finally locates the disabled boat, rescues the crew, treats injured passengers, and carries them back to safety.
